Overview

Intelligent system modules are advanced components that integrate sensors, processors, and communication interfaces to enable smart, autonomous functionality. These modules are designed to perform complex tasks with minimal human intervention, making them essential in modern automation and IoT applications. They are used across various industries, including manufacturing, healthcare, and consumer electronics, to enhance efficiency, reduce operational costs, and improve decision-making through real-time data processing and analysis.

Structure and Working Principle

An intelligent system module typically consists of a microcontroller or microprocessor, sensors for data acquisition, and communication interfaces such as Wi-Fi, Bluetooth, or Zigbee. The module processes input data from sensors and executes predefined algorithms to perform specific tasks. The working principle involves continuous data collection, processing, and decision-making based on embedded software. For example, in a smart home system, the module might analyze temperature data from sensors and adjust the HVAC system accordingly.

Key Features

Intelligent system modules are characterized by their ability to perform autonomous or semi-autonomous tasks, often in real-time. Key features include high processing power, low power consumption, and robust communication capabilities. Many modules also support machine learning algorithms, enabling them to adapt and improve performance over time. This makes them ideal for applications requiring predictive analytics and adaptive control.

Application Areas

These modules are widely used in industrial automation, where they control machinery and monitor production processes. In consumer electronics, they enable smart home devices like thermostats and security systems. Other applications include healthcare monitoring systems, autonomous vehicles, and agricultural automation, where they help optimize resource usage and improve operational efficiency.

Maintenance and Precautions

Proper maintenance of intelligent system modules involves regular firmware updates and periodic checks of sensor accuracy. It's important to follow manufacturer guidelines to ensure longevity and optimal performance. Precautions include protecting the module from extreme temperatures, moisture, and electromagnetic interference. Ensuring compatibility with existing systems is also crucial to avoid operational issues.

B2B Procurement Guide

When procuring intelligent system modules, B2B buyers should consider factors such as application requirements, scalability, and vendor support. It's advisable to evaluate the module's processing power, communication capabilities, and compatibility with existing infrastructure. Buyers should also assess the vendor's reputation, technical support, and after-sales service. Bulk purchases may offer cost advantages, but it's essential to ensure the modules meet the specific needs of the intended application.
